Transaction 13f3885669d1a4a5f16f450af2bb1afed80ade082a60f741c96630b5e873bf96
1 Input
1 Output
-
13f3885669d1a4a5f16f450af2bb1afed80ade082a60f741c96630b5e873bf96:0
- value
- 848626
- script pubkey
- OP_0 OP_PUSHBYTES_20 45ce3843188420a517eb6a40da82b77477400899
- address
- bc1qgh8rssccsss229ltdfqd4q4hw3m5qzyerus670